Tinnitus is a ringing, swishing, or other kind of noise that seems to start in the ear or head. It can be a common experience and is mainly the perception of sounds that are not coming from the outer environment.

Tinnitus can be uneven or constant and the volume ranges from mild to deafening. It arises in the absence of sound indicators from the ears merely because there’s or complete hearing loss. Therefore it is ultimately the perception of a ringing tone in the ears that can be heard only by the one experiencing the tinnitus.

Tinnitus can sound akin to a drum, whistle, fuzz, screech, hum, crickets, buzz, something else, or any blend of the above. Tinnitus can also be a symptom of strengthening of the middle ear bones (otosclerosis). This condition is regularly more troublesome when the surroundings are silent, particularly when lying in bed. It is not, however, a brain disease, and it is most definitely not a symptom of a psychiatric illness or hysteria.

Frequent exposure to loud noises for example guns, firecrackers, aircraft, lawn mowers, movie theatres, loud music, commercial construction, will normally result in cochlea damage, which in turn forces tinnitus. Noise-induced hearing loss is normally joined by hyperacusis, which is a lowered tolerance to higher levels of sound. Tinnitus has been associated to:

- ear pain
- circulatory system difficutlys
- noise-induced hearing loss
- wax increase in one’s ear canal
- medications harmful to one’s ear
- ear and sinus infections
- badly aligned jaw joints
- head or neck injury
- Meniere’s disease
- abnormal development of all bones in one’s middle ear.

Incorrect wax removal can force damage to one’s ear drums and end up as irreversible hearing loss. In some cases there can be an obvious source for the tinnitus, for example a noise causes hearing loss, medicine, or ear disease. An associated hearing loss with tinnitus is regularly present.
